1. Understanding Dark Circles and Their Causes
Before choosing any eye cream for dark circles, it’s important to understand what's causing them. For many, it’s not just about tiredness. Genetics, poor circulation, thinning under-eye skin, allergies, and even lifestyle habits like smoking or poor sleep hygiene can all contribute. In some cases, pigmentation is to blame; in others, the shadow effect caused by under-eye hollowness.

2. Key Ingredients to Look for in Soothing Eye Creams
2.1 Caffeine for Puffiness and Circulation
Caffeine is one of the most effective ingredients for reducing puffiness and temporarily improving circulation. It works by constricting blood vessels, which reduces the appearance of dark shadows under the eyes.
2.2 Peptides and Hyaluronic Acid for Skin Renewal
These ingredients help rebuild the delicate under-eye tissue and retain moisture. Peptides support collagen production, making the skin appear plumper, while hyaluronic acid prevents dryness, which can make dark circles appear more severe.
2.3 Soothers Like Chamomile, Aloe, and Green Tea
To calm irritation and inflammation, look for creams containing chamomile extract, aloe vera, or green tea. These natural ingredients help reduce redness and discomfort while promoting hydration and skin recovery.
3. How to Apply Eye Cream Correctly for Best Results
3.1 Less Is More
A common mistake is using too much product. A rice grain-sized amount is typically enough for both eyes. Gently dab the cream around the orbital bone using your ring finger—the weakest finger, which reduces pressure and helps prevent skin damage.
3.2 Morning and Night Routine
For best results, apply eye cream twice daily: once in the morning to protect and energise the area, and once at night to nourish and repair. Be consistent, as eye creams for dark circles often take 4–6 weeks to show noticeable improvements.
3.3 Avoid Getting Too Close to the Eye
Your body heat naturally moves the product upwards. Applying too close to the lash line may cause irritation or watery eyes. Stick to the bone structure around the eyes for a safe, effective application.
4. Choosing Eye Creams Based on Skin Type
4.1 Sensitive Skin Needs Gentle Formulas
If your under-eye area is prone to redness or stinging, avoid harsh retinols or overly fragrant formulas. Look for hypoallergenic options and those labelled for sensitive skin.
4.2 Oily or Acne-Prone Skin
For those with oily or acne-prone skin, opt for lightweight gel-based eye creams. These absorb quickly and don’t clog pores, which is especially important if you’re applying makeup afterwards.
4.3 Mature or Dry Skin
Creams with nourishing oils like jojoba, squalane, or ceramides are great for ageing or dry skin types. These ingredients help lock in moisture and support skin repair overnight.
